Constantly supported Node.js module providing random emojis, including their names and categories. The module also offers random Japanese kaomojis.
npm install @sefinek/random-emoji
Function | Description |
---|---|
unicode | Get a single emoji |
emojis | Get a random emoji with its name and type |
cats | Get a random cat |
hearts | Get a random heart |
foods | Get a random food |
circles | Get a random circle |
new Kaomojis | Get random kaomojis from the API |
const random = require('@sefinek/random-emoji');
// 1. A single emoji
console.log(random.unicode()); // π₯°
// 2. Random emoji along with its visual representation, name, and category
const emoji = random.emojis();
console.log(`Emoji: ${emoji.content}; Name: ${emoji.name}; Type: ${emoji.type}`);
// Emoji: πΆ; Name: Dog Face; Type: animal
// 3. Random cat
const cat = random.cats();
console.log(`Emoji: ${cat.content}; Name: ${cat.name}`);
// Emoji: πΊ; Name: smiley_cat
const random = require('@sefinek/random-emoji');
(async () => {
const kaomoji = new random.Kaomojis();
const uwu = await kaomoji.uwu();
console.log('Random UwU:', uwu.message);
})();
const random = require('@sefinek/random-emoji');
const kaomoji = new random.Kaomojis();
kaomoji.uwu().then(data => console.log(data));
// or shorter
kaomoji.uwu().then(console.log);
Β» The returned object from API
{
"success": true,
"status": 200,
"info": {
"category": "kaomoji",
"endpoint": "uwu"
},
"message": "οΌ΅ο½οΌ΅"
}
Function | Link to the API | Version | Example |
---|---|---|---|
cat() |
Click here | v2 | (=^-Ο-^=) |
dog() |
Click here | v2 | ΰ¬(βͺγ»ο»γ»βͺ)ΰ¬ |
owo() |
Click here | v2 | πππ |
uwu() |
Click here | v2 | ππ¨π |
love() |
Click here | v2 | γ½(β‘βΏβ‘)γ |
Need assistance or have questions about this module? Don't hesitate to open a new Issue on our GitHub repository. Our community is ready to help and provide answers to your inquiries.
If you use the Random Emoji module and appreciate my work, I'd be grateful if you could give it a star on our GitHub page. Your support helps me continue to develop this project and provide new and fun emojis to every user.
π β’ MIT License
Copyright 2022-2024 Β© by Sefinek. All Rights Reserved.